The base unit itself is supplied in the Cooler Master box which originally contained the empty chassis. This packaging should provide the system with enough protection during shipping, while cutting down on unnecessary waste of extra packaging.

IMG_0431

Braebo sent all of the accessories in a separate box which appeared to have endured a bit of a battering by the courier. Some of the packaging of the peripherals was damaged a little but there was no damage to the items themselves. Our particular system was sent with an Iiyama ProLite E2480HS 24” monitor, a CM Storm Quick Fire Pro mechanical keyboard, a CM Storm Sentinel Advance II gaming mouse, a set of Logitech LS21 2.1 speakers and a CM Storm Sirus headset.
